Frequently Asked Questions about Wharton

How much are Studio apartments in Wharton?

There are currently 9 Studio Apartments in Wharton with rent ranges from $499 to $1,305 with an average price of $863.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Wharton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Wharton ranges from $530 to $2,416 with an average monthly rent of $1,337.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Wharton c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Wharton range from $645 to $5,515.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,615.

How expensive are Wharton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Wharton on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,018 to $5,800 - averaging $1,925 for the location.
